Perfect Match is heating up!

The Netflix dating competition series returned for a fourth season on May 13 and introduced a new group of hopeful single reality television stars to the dreamy villa. As the show plays out, each person will try to develop a meaningful connection and will get their relationships tested by their fellow contestants and new singles.

Ahead of the season premiere, the streamer announced the cast — which includes Ally Lewber (Vanderpump Rules), Chris Dahlan (Age of Attraction), DeMari Davis (Too Hot to Handle), Jimmy Presnell (Love Is Blind), Kassy Castillo (Love Island) and Sophie Willett (Love Is Blind UK), among others.

Once again, Nick Lachey was tapped to host the show and crown one couple the eventual Perfect Match. However, unlike past seasons, season 4 will include a twist that allows more contestants to enter and stay there longer.

Here's everything to know about the Perfect Match season 4 release schedule.

When does Perfect Match season 4 premiere?

Perfect Match season 4 premiered Wednesday, May 13. The first five episodes were all released on the same day.

The first installment hit the streamer at 3 a.m. ET / 12 a.m. PT.

How many episodes are in Perfect Match season 4?

There are a total of eight episodes in Perfect Match season 4. The premiere drop includes the first five episodes, which will be followed by the next two episodes and then the finale episode.

If season 4 matches the structure of the last three seasons, the first handful of episodes will follow the contestants as they pair up with each other and deepen their connections while competing in compatibility challenges. As the series plays out, those compatible couples will get the power to choose new singles to bring into the game — and can even control who that person goes on a date with.

After a new person comes in, the contestants have to match with each other all over again, so they can shake up the villa if someone chooses to leave their match for a newbie.

"The producers aren't steering the ship," creator Chris Coelen told Tudum of the show. "If the participants choose to bring these people in or match 'em up with whoever, it's totally up to them. That's much more real, and it's much more fun for them."

From there, anyone left without a match must exit the game. At the end of the game, only one couple is given the winning title of Perfect Match.

When do new episodes of Perfect Match come out?

New episodes of Perfect Match are released on Netflix every Wednesday, beginning May 13, at 3 a.m. ET / 12 a.m. PT.

What is the Perfect Match season 4 episode release schedule?

Season 4 of Perfect Match will release its eight episodes over three Wednesdays. Below is the Perfect Match season 4 release schedule.

May 13: Episodes 1-5

May 20: Episodes 6-7

May 27: Episode 8, the finale

Where can I watch Perfect Match?

Perfect Match is available to stream on Netflix. In addition to the current season, the previous three seasons are also available on the streamer.
